Math

  • The child learned about measurement and spatial awareness by building the Lego tower to a specific height or width.
  • They practiced counting and number sense when determining the number of Lego bricks used in the tower.
  • The child developed problem-solving skills by figuring out how to balance the tower and ensure it stood upright.
  • They explored patterns and symmetry by creating different designs and structures with the Lego bricks.

For continued development, encourage the child to experiment with different shapes and sizes of Lego bricks to create more challenging towers. They can also try incorporating mathematical concepts such as multiplication or division by using specific numbers of bricks to build the tower.
